THE Sandakan by-election will take place on May 11, and nomination on April 27, said the Election Commission today.

The seat fell vacant after its MP, Stephen Wong, died of a heart attack on March 28.

Early voting will be on May 7, EC chairman Azhar Azizan Harun told a press conference in Putrajaya.

“The campaign period for the by-election is 14 days, from nomination day until 11.59pm on May 10.

“The EC has appointed Mohamad Hamsan Awang Supain from the Sandakan Municipal Council as the returning officer. He will be aided by five assistants.

“The SMK Tiong Hua Sandakan activity hall will serve as the nomination centre and vote-tallying centre.”

He said voters can cast their ballots between 8am and 5.30pm.

The polls process will be live-streamed via the EC’s Facebook page, he added.

“We have 770 EC staff to handle the by-election. There will be 21 polling centres with 92 streams.

“The budget for the by-election is estimated at RM3.1 million.”

Azhar said the commission targets a 70% turnout.

“We hope the media will encourage people to cast their votes on polling day.

“There will be an extra 17 polling streams to avoid congestion, making for a total of 92 streams.”

It was reported that Wong’s daughter, Vivian, is among the names suggested as Sabah DAP’s candidate for the by-election.

Vivian, who holds a degree in mass communications, had worked as an officer to her father in the state Health and Well-being Ministry, which he led. – April 5, 2019.
